Shakespeare in a divided America : what his plays tell us about our past and future / James Shapiro.

Summary:

"From leading Shakespeare scholar James Shapiro, a timely and insightful examination of what the world's greatest dramatist can teach us about life in an America riven by conflict"-- Provided by publisher.
